Let’s talk shop? Tell us more about your career, what can you share with our community?
In the writing process, we focus a lot more on melody and harmony, as well as instrumentals that are more of a modern take on the ’90s Skate Punk era fused with that “old-school” punk feeling. We’ve been very excited about our second album, “It Can’t Get Much Better Than This”. (out on all streaming!!) When we released this album we did a tour throughout the Midwest, which has provided us with amazing opportunities since. At the start of the band, we spent a lot of time trying to find our sound and how we fit into the scene. That has definitely been one of the hardest challenges we’ve had to overcome at this point, but there are definitely more to come in the future. The biggest lesson we’ve learned is to be proactive and not reactive to your environment. You can’t sit around and make things happen, you have to make them happen.
